Joint Venture in Russia: Greiner Packaging steadily forges ahead with expansion

Greiner Packaging is establishing a joint venture with the Russian company Plastic System. Under the name Greiner Packaging System, the joint venture – located in Noginsk – will be driven by a focus on IML, direct printing and larger packaging containers primarily in the food and non-food sector in Russia.

Greiner Packaging is establishing a joint venture with the Russian plastic packaging manufacturer Plastic System, which serves the market under the Souzpromplast brand. The new company is being established under the name Greiner Packaging System, with Greiner Packaging holding the majority of the shares.

After the Turkey expansion in 2015 and the establishment of a joint venture in India in 2016, Greiner Packaging is continuing its internationalization strategy this year as well. “Our goal is to grow outside of Europe as well in the future, in order to be better able to respond to international customer needs,” says Axel Kühner, Chairman of the Greiner Group.

A step towards growth through synergy effects

Greiner Packaging has already been successfully represented in the Russian market with a site in Vladimir since 2005, with the key technologies so far being thermoforming in conjunction with the K3® cardboard-plastic-combination. The goal of the joint venture now is to reinforce activities in Russia and to drive the market through new innovations. The offerings for the Russian market can be expanded through the second site. In particular, the competence in the IML and direct printing sector will be strengthened and the product portfolio expanded to larger packaging units. Synergies with the existing plant will be exploited and new options developed.

“This partnership in Russia is further validation that our international path is a successful approach. The Russian market offers great potential and, together with our experienced partners, we expect a significant growth spurt. The joint venture will allow us to expand our product portfolio and strengthen our market position as well,” stresses Manfred Stanek, division head of Greiner Packaging International.

The formal closing of the joint venture was in March, with both partners currently working on the implementation of the agreed-upon integration measures.

About Plastic System

The Plastic System company, which serves its customers under the Souzpromplast brand, is headquartered in Noginsk, about 40 kilometers east of Moscow. It is one of the leading suppliers of plastic packaging on the Russian market and supplies multinational customers, among them Henkel, Heinz or Meffert, in accordance with modern European standards. The portfolio of the ISO 9001:2008 certified company includes packaging for the food and non-food sector and it is a key player in the industry, primarily in the field of buckets for paints and chemicals.
